Energy demands balers with fixed and variable compression chamber
SKALICKÝ, Martin
This bachelor thesis focuses on the comparison of energy demands of fixed- and variable- chamber silage balers. The first part of the thesis deals with the fodder plants (importance, crop and agrophysical characteristics) and pick-up balers (agrotechnical requirements, division, description and construction of balers). The second part contains measured values and results. To compare the energy demands I have chosen the fixed-chamber silage baler CLAAS ROLLANT 250 ROTOCUT and the variable-chamber silage baler KRONE VARIOPACK 1800 MULTICUT. With both balers I compared their unit weight, performance and fuel consumption measuring. The measuring took place during the hey and silage crops (three cuttings). The gathered data was used for further calculations.
